The CODEX-1 study is a multicenter retrospective observational study designed to assess the diagnostic performance of a novel software application for coronary artery disease (CAD) evaluation. The application integrates automated stenosis detection, CT-derived fractional flow reserve (CT-FFR), and plaque quantification, all performed on-site. A total of 1,000 patients who previously underwent coronary computed tomography angiography (CCTA) and diagnostic invasive coronary angiography (ICA) and/or other non-invasive imaging will be included. The study compares the diagnostic outputs of the software to current clinical practice and expert adjudication, focusing on CAD-RADS categorization, prediction of the need for percutaneous coronary intervention (PCI), and reduction in unnecessary ICA procedures.
